Front panel and controls

1-6. Buttons 1-6. Preset (radio). Selecting a CD (CD player). Button 6: Dolby BNR noise reduction system on/off (cassette player)

7. ON button. Power on/off

8. "-" button. Volume down, bass down, treble down, left/right speaker balance, front/rear speaker balance

9. "+" button. Volume up, bass boost, treble boost, left/right speaker balance, front/rear speaker balance

10. BAL/FAD button. Press once: left/right speaker balance. Press twice: front/rear speaker balance

11. BAS/TRE button. Press once: selects the bass tone control. Press twice: selects the treble tone control

12. TA/AF button Short press: Priority for traffic information (tA indicator is on). Long press: Turns on/off the AF function to automatically search for the broadcast frequency of the selected RDS station that provides the best signal reception

13. BND/ AST button. Short press: Switches the FM1/ FM2/ AST/ MW/ LW ranges. Long press: Enables automatic memorization of FM stations (Autostore)

14. OPEN button. Opening/closing the front curtain

15. Button . Short press: auto reverse. Long press: eject cassette

16. Front curtain

17. Cassette player

18. Button . Manual search for radio stations, search for the beginning of the previous recording on a cassette, search for the beginning of the previous track on a CD player

19. Button . Automatic search for radio stations, fast rewind of cassette tape, search for the beginning of the previous track on the CD player

20. Button . Manual search for radio stations, search for the beginning of the next recording on a cassette, search for the beginning of the next track on a CD player

21. Button . Automatic radio station search, fast forward of cassette tape, fast head movement to the beginning of CD

22. SCN/RDM button Short press: scan preset stations (radio), scanning tape recordings, scanning CD tracks

23. SRC/ button. Short press: switching the radio operating mode (receiver/cassette/CD player). Long press: mute

24. Anti-theft indicator light




Digital display readings



1. Frequency of the received radio signal and range, name of the received station, other information

2. AF function enabled (frequency search to improve signal reception quality)
3. TA mode enabled (priority of traffic information)
4. The receiving station transmits information about the traffic situation
5. The received station is part of the EON network 6. Stereo signal reception
7. Numbers 1-6 - the preset number on the receiver, the CD number in the store
8. Dolby BNR system is enabled
9. "Metal" or "chrome" type cassette playback
10. Automatic memorization of FM stations is enabled


Remote control lever on the steering column



A. Increasing the volume of the sound

B. Decreasing the sound volume
C. Automatic station search, search for the beginning of the next recording on a tape, search for the beginning of the next track on a CD player
D. Automatic station search, search for the beginning of the previous recording on the tape, search for the beginning of the previous track on the CD player
E. Selecting the operating mode of the radio (receiver/audio cassette player/CD player).
F. Range selection (with one touch), reverse the direction of playback of a recording on a cassette, select the next CD (with one touch)




Technical specifications



Anti-theft: Encrypted device with 4-digit code.

Remote control: a lever with controls mounted on the steering column.

Audio system:
  • mute sound.
  • output power: 4x30 W (4x10 W) with a nonlinear distortion coefficient of up to 1%.

Radio receiver: RDS radio data system.

Receiver frequency ranges:
  • FM: 87.5-108 MHz;
  • MW (medium waves): 531–1629 kHz;
  • LW (long waves): 144–288 kHz.

Number of settings to be fixed:
  • FM (automatic memorization in AST mode): 6;
  • FM (manual memorization): 12 (2 sub-ranges FM1 and FM2 with 6 stations each);
  • MW (manual memorization): 6;
  • LW (manual memorization): 6.

Audio cassette player:
  • autoreverse
  • automatic tape type detector
  • search recording by pauses
  • scanning records
  • dolby B noise reduction system

CD player:
  • 6 CD magazine
  • fast movement of the reading head
  • automatic track search
  • scan tracks
  • random playback order of records.

All messages concerning the operating modes of the radio are displayed on the central display of the vehicle control panel.

Anti-theft coding device



The device is based on a microprocessor. After disconnecting the car radio from the car's electrical network (removing the battery, dismantling the radio or installing it for the first time) you must enter a security code. The radio can only be turned on after entering the correct code.

Enter code



1. Turn on the radio with the ON button. Press the preset button 1. The display will show 0 - - -. Press the buttons 18 or 20 several times until the first digit of the code (7 - - -) appears on the display.



2. To confirm the first digit and proceed to entering the second digit of the code, press button 1. The display will show 70 - - -. Press buttons 18 or 20 several times until the second digit of the code (73 - -) appears on the display.

3. Follow these steps to enter the correct code and finally press button 1 to confirm the fourth digit of the code. If the code entered is correct, you will hear a short high-pitched signal. The radio is ready for operation.

Case of entering the wrong code



If an error is made when entering the code, a short low-tone signal will sound. The display will show the message "ERR CODE". A repeat attempt to enter the code is only possible after a pause of 1 minute. The waiting period is doubled after another unsuccessful attempt. This period is limited to approximately 32 minutes. Switching off the radio does not affect the duration of the mandatory pause. The pause time will start again when the radio is switched on. After the pause has ended, the display will show the message "CODE". Now you can enter the code.

The red indicator 24 flashes when the ignition is on, indicating that the anti-theft device is on. The indicator goes out when the ignition or radio is turned on.

After disconnecting or reconnecting the battery, the message "CODE" appears on the display of the radio. Enter the code.

Radio



All the main functions performed by the radio receiver are similar to the 4030 car radio. In addition, the following functions have been added:



Scanning pre-selected radio stations. The radio provides the ability to scan six pre-selected stations in any range. During the scanning process, you can select one of them.

Scanning pre-selected radio stations operating in one range. Select the range you wish to scan. Briefly press the SCN 22 button. When scanning, all pre-selected radio stations operating in this range are switched on in turn. The order is determined by the order of the memory cells assigned to buttons 1-6. Scanning begins with the radio station entered into the memory cell of button 1, or with the radio station following the one currently selected. Approximate duration of listening to each station (tA mode is off) is:
  • five seconds with good reception quality;
  • approximately one second with a weak radio signal.

Approximate listening time for each station (tA mode is on) is:
  • five seconds for radio stations capable of transmitting traffic announcements;
  • approximately one second for radio stations not capable of transmitting traffic announcements.

Selecting a radio station during scanning. Briefly press the SCN 22 button while listening to a radio station you like to keep the radio tuned to that station. The order in which the radio tunes to pre-selected radio stations does not change.

Interrupting Scan To interrupt scanning of pre-selected radio stations:
  • select any radio station;
  • select any function other than those activated by the TA/AF button 12.

Audio cassette player



Searching for the beginning of a recording by a pause. This function allows you to start playing the current recording from the beginning or the next recording on the tape. This function is based on searching for pauses between recordings. Searching for the beginning of a recording can also be done using the remote control lever on the steering column.



Search for the beginning of the previous recording. To search for the beginning of the current recording, press button 18. While searching for the beginning of a recording, the sound is muted and the message "PREV 1" is displayed. After the beginning of a recording is found, playback resumes. This function can also be activated using the remote control lever. Pressing button 18 n times skips to the beginning of the (n-1)th recording, counting from the current one. The message "PREV n" is displayed. While searching for the beginning of the desired recording, the sound is muted and the display shows the transitions from the beginning of one recording to the beginning of the next. After the beginning of the desired recording is found, playback resumes. Each time button 18 is pressed, the value of n on the display increases by one.

Searching for the beginning of the next track. To search for the beginning of the next track, press button 20. While searching for the beginning of a track, the sound is muted and the display shows "NEXT 1". Once the beginning of a track is found, playback resumes. This function can also be activated using the remote control lever on the steering column. Pressing button 20 n times skips to the beginning of the nth track, counting from the current track. The display shows "NEXT n". While searching for the beginning of the desired track, the sound is muted and the display shows the transitions from the beginning of one track to the beginning of the next. Once the beginning of the desired track is found, playback resumes. Each time button 20 is pressed, the value of n on the display increases by one.



Scanning records. The scanning function allows you to quickly listen to the initial fragments of all records on an audio cassette. Scanning is based on the use of pauses between records. Briefly press the SCN/RDM 22 button to start scanning. The message "SCAN" will appear on the display. The player will play 10-second initial fragments of all records on the audio cassette, starting with the record that follows the current one. To stop scanning, briefly press the SCN/RDM 22 button again. Playback will begin from the record where scanning was interrupted.

CD player



Scanning a CD. Briefly press the SCN/RDM button 22. Each track on the CD will be played for ten seconds. The display shows "SC [track number]". To stop scanning, briefly press the "SCN/RDM" button 22 again. Playback of the CD will resume from the track that was playing when scanning was cancelled.

Playing tracks in random order. Press the "SCN/RDM" button 22 and hold it for at least two seconds. A short beep confirms that the random playback mode has been activated. Playback begins with the disc you were listening to when the mode was activated. First, the CD player plays all tracks on the current CD in random order, then moves on to the following CDs. When the entire stock of CDs in the disc magazine is exhausted, the CD player returns to the first CD. When playing tracks in random order, the display constantly shows the message "RD [track number] CD" and the number of the CD being played. [Track number] determines the position of the track on the CD. To cancel the random playback mode, press the SCN/RDM button 22 again and hold it for at least two seconds.
